Report: Abrams setting up Episode VII post-production facilities in L.A.

JJ AbramsAccording to the Hollywood Reporter, J.J. Abrams is setting up an Episode VII post-production shop at the Bad Robot facility in Santa Monica. Among the additions:

A green room, sound studios and other new facilities will be developed within the three-story, 18,000-square-foot Santa Monica building, which already includes editing bays, a workshop for making props, a screening room that can double as a set and Abrams’ personal suite of offices. Star Wars: Episode VII is set to be released in 2015 by Disney.
